The cost of hiring an IP attorney in Trondheim for trademark registration typically includes:
Legal fees: NOK 8,000-15,000 for basic trademark filing
Official filing fees: NOK 2,900 for online filing in one class (as of 2023)
Additional classes: NOK 900 per class
Total costs vary based on complexity, search requirements, and whether international protection is needed. Most Trondheim IP attorneys offer initial consultations to provide specific cost estimates for your situation.
